DESCRIPTION:Speakers: Mandy Cooper-Sarkar (Oxford University)\nWe present 
 the HERAFitter project which provides a framework for Quantum\nChromodynam
 ics (QCD) analyses related to the proton structure in the\ncontext of mult
 i-processes and multi-experiments.\nBased on the concept of factorisable n
 ature of the cross sections into\nuniversal parton distribution functions 
 (PDFs) and process dependent\npartonic scattering cross sections\, HERAFit
 ter allows determination of\nPDFs from the various hard scattering measure
 ments.\nHere we report a set of parton distribution functions determined w
 ith\nthe HERAFitter program using HERA data and preserving correlations\nb
 etween uncertainties for the LO\, NLO and NNLO sets. The sets are used\nto
  study uncertainties for ratios of cross sections at LHC calculated at\ndi
 fferent order in QCD. A reduction of overall theoretical uncertainty\nis o
 bserved in this case.\n\nhttps://indico.ific.uv.es/event/2025/contribution
